Win8下运行XP虚拟机教程

windows8 运行xp虚拟机

时间:2025-02-05 21:59


Windows 8 上运行 XP 虚拟机:高效融合经典与现代的终极指南 在科技日新月异的今天,操作系统作为数字世界的基石,不断进化以适应新的硬件技术和用户需求

    Windows 8,作为微软推出的具有划时代意义的操作系统,引入了全新的用户界面和交互方式,旨在提升用户体验和工作效率

    然而,对于一些特定应用场景或旧软件的兼容性需求,Windows XP——这个曾经风靡一时的操作系统,仍然保持着其不可替代的地位

    幸运的是,通过虚拟机技术,我们可以在Windows 8环境中无缝运行Windows XP,实现经典与现代操作系统的完美融合

    本文将深入探讨如何在Windows 8上高效运行XP虚拟机,为您的工作和生活带来便利

     一、虚拟机技术简介 虚拟机(Virtual Machine, VM)是一种软件实现的计算机模拟环境,它能够在单一物理硬件上运行多个操作系统实例

    每个虚拟机都拥有自己的CPU、内存、硬盘等虚拟硬件资源,彼此之间相互隔离,互不干扰

    这种技术不仅提高了资源利用率,还为软件开发、测试、旧软件运行等提供了极大的灵活性

     二、为何在Windows 8上运行XP虚拟机 1.兼容性需求:某些老旧应用程序或专业软件可能仅支持Windows XP,而在新系统上直接运行会遇到兼容性问题

    通过虚拟机运行XP,可以确保这些关键应用的持续运行

     2.安全性考量:在不破坏主系统安全的前提下,使用虚拟机隔离运行可能含有病毒或恶意软件的旧程序,有效保护主机环境

     3.资源高效利用:虚拟机允许用户根据需要动态分配资源,避免了为单一旧软件购买额外硬件的成本

     4.便捷的学习与测试:对于技术人员、学生或爱好者而言,虚拟机提供了一个安全、可控的环境来学习和测试不同版本的操作系统、软件或进行故障排除

     三、选择适合的虚拟机软件 在Windows 8上运行XP虚拟机,首先需要一款可靠的虚拟机软件

    以下是几款流行的选择: 1.VMware Workstation/Player:以其强大的性能和广泛的兼容性著称,支持多种操作系统,包括Windows XP

    其直观的界面和丰富的功能集使其成为专业人士的首选

     2.Oracle VirtualBox:开源免费,易于安装和配置,对资源占用相对较小,非常适合个人用户和教育用途

     3.Microsoft Virtual PC(虽已停止更新,但仍可用于兼容性测试):专为Windows设计,与微软生态系统高度集成,适合轻量级需求

     四、安装与配置XP虚拟机步骤 以下以Oracle VirtualBox为例,详细介绍安装与配置XP虚拟机的过程: 1.下载并安装VirtualBox:从Oracle官网下载最新版本的VirtualBox安装程序,按照提示完成安装

     2.创建虚拟机: - 打开VirtualBox,点击“新建”按钮

     - 为虚拟机命名,选择操作系统类型为“Microsoft Windows”,版本选择“Windows XP”

     - 分配内存大小,建议至少分配512MB至1GB,具体取决于您的物理内存大小和XP虚拟机上的预期负载

     - 创建虚拟硬盘,选择“动态分配”以节省空间,或“固定大小”以获得更好的性能

    指定硬盘大小,一般建议20GB至40GB

     3.安装Windows XP: - 在虚拟机设置中挂载Windows XP安装ISO文件

     - 启动虚拟机,按提示进入XP安装流程

     - 完成安装后,安装VirtualBox Guest Additions以增强图形性能、实现共享文件夹等功能

     4.优化虚拟机性能: - 根据实际需求调整虚拟机设置,如CPU核心数、显存大小等

     - 确保虚拟机使用NAT或桥接网络模式,以便根据需要访问互联网或局域网资源

     五、提升虚拟机使用体验的技巧 1.共享文件夹:利用Guest Additions设置共享文件夹,实现主机与虚拟机之间的文件快速传输

     2.无缝模式:在支持无缝模式的虚拟机软件中,可以开启此功能,使虚拟机窗口中的应用程序以窗口或全屏方式直接在主机桌面上运行,提升操作流畅度

     3.快照管理:定期创建虚拟机快照,以便在遇到问题时快速恢复到之前的状态,保护数据安全和工作进度

     4.资源监控与调整:监控虚拟机的CPU、内存使用情况,适时调整资源分配,确保主机和虚拟机都能流畅运行

     六、注意事项与安全建议 - 定期更新:虽然XP已不再接收官方安全更新,但在虚拟机中运行时,仍建议安装可用的补丁和防病毒软件,以减少安全风险

     - 备份重要数据:定期备份虚拟机文件和共享数据,以防数据丢失

     - 权限管理:合理设置虚拟机用户权限,避免不必要的风险操作

     七、结语 在Windows 8上运行XP虚拟机,不仅解决了旧软件兼容性问题,还为用户提供了一个安全、灵活的测试和学习环境

    通过选择合适的虚拟机软件、合理配置与优化,我们可以在享受Windows 8带来的现代体验的同时,无缝对接经典操作系统,实现工作效率的最大化

    随着技术的不断进步,虚拟机技术将在更多领域发挥其独特价值,助力个人与企业跨越技术的代际鸿沟,迈向更加高效、安全的数字化未来